A build error occurred by ADF v2.2 with IDF v4.2 system.

pavepart
Posts: 9
Joined: Thu Jun 25, 2020 4:38 am

A build error occurred by ADF v2.2 with IDF v4.2 system.

Postby pavepart » Mon Jan 04, 2021 8:18 am

I downloaded ADF 2.2 version. And set IDF 4.2 version where in [esp-adf/esp-idf] folder.
The IDF HelloWorld example works well.
However, an error occurred when I build an ADF example(play_mp3).
Looking for a solution. Please help me.

The error message like this.






C:\msys32\home\Firmware\new-adf\examples\get-started\play_mp3>idf.py build
Executing action: all (aliases: build)
Running cmake in directory c:\msys32\home\firmware\new-adf\examples\get-started\play_mp3\build
Executing "cmake -G Ninja -DPYTHON_DEPS_CHECKED=1 -DESP_PLATFORM=1 -DCCACHE_ENABLE=1 c:\msys32\home\firmware\new-adf\examples\get-started\play_mp3"...
-- Found Git: C:/Program Files/Git/cmd/git.exe (found version "2.21.0.windows.1")
-- IDF_TARGET not set, using default target: esp32
-- ccache will be used for faster recompilation
-- The C compiler identification is GNU 8.4.0
-- The CXX compiler identification is GNU 8.4.0
-- The ASM compiler identification is GNU
-- Found assembler: C:/esp/tools/.espressif/tools/xtensa-esp32-elf/esp-2020r3-8.4.0/xtensa-esp32-elf/bin/xtensa-esp32-elf-gcc.exe
-- Check for working C compiler: C:/esp/tools/.espressif/tools/xtensa-esp32-elf/esp-2020r3-8.4.0/xtensa-esp32-elf/bin/xtensa-esp32-elf-gcc.exe
-- Check for working C compiler: C:/esp/tools/.espressif/tools/xtensa-esp32-elf/esp-2020r3-8.4.0/xtensa-esp32-elf/bin/xtensa-esp32-elf-gcc.exe -- works
-- Detecting C compiler ABI info
-- Detecting C compiler ABI info - done
-- Detecting C compile features
-- Detecting C compile features - done
-- Check for working CXX compiler: C:/esp/tools/.espressif/tools/xtensa-esp32-elf/esp-2020r3-8.4.0/xtensa-esp32-elf/bin/xtensa-esp32-elf-g++.exe
-- Check for working CXX compiler: C:/esp/tools/.espressif/tools/xtensa-esp32-elf/esp-2020r3-8.4.0/xtensa-esp32-elf/bin/xtensa-esp32-elf-g++.exe -- works
-- Detecting CXX compiler ABI info
-- Detecting CXX compiler ABI info - done
-- Detecting CXX compile features
-- Detecting CXX compile features - done
-- Building ESP-IDF components for target esp32
CMake Error at C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:186 (message):
Failed to resolve component 'esp-adf-libs'.
Call Stack (most recent call first):
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:212 (__build_resolve_and_add_req)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:213 (__build_expand_requirements)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:218 (__build_expand_requirements)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:218 (__build_expand_requirements)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:218 (__build_expand_requirements)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/build.cmake:426 (__build_expand_requirements)
C:/msys32/home/Firmware/new-adf/esp-idf/tools/cmake/project.cmake:395 (idf_build_process)
CMakeLists.txt:8 (project)


-- Configuring incomplete, errors occurred!
See also "C:/msys32/home/Firmware/new-adf/examples/get-started/play_mp3/build/CMakeFiles/CMakeOutput.log".
cmake failed with exit code 1

MSD-Systems
Posts: 3
Joined: Fri Jan 08, 2021 6:10 pm

Re: A build error occurred by ADF v2.2 with IDF v4.2 system.

Postby MSD-Systems » Fri Jan 08, 2021 6:40 pm

Hi,

it seems you are missing the 'esp-adf-libs'.

Did you have done a correct clone ?

Code: Select all

git clone --recursive https://github.com/espressif/esp-adf.git
best regards

luxianquan
Posts: 18
Joined: Tue Jul 13, 2021 12:23 pm

Re: A build error occurred by ADF v2.2 with IDF v4.2 system.

Postby luxianquan » Wed Jul 21, 2021 9:08 am

You should run code "set ADF_PATH=your_adf_path" first then run "idf.py build"
I faced the same problem and solved like this way.

Who is online

Users browsing this forum: No registered users and 38 guests